Output 21f63929102db148c9432c879f8d1421e50cc4a1ade4e94a65276da69c46ac62:4

value
6656172
script pubkey
OP_0 OP_PUSHBYTES_20 0cb3d17747dd50b51ccf5ac68e28b0504974e9ba
address
bc1qpjeaza68m4gt28x0ttrgu29s2pyhf6d6dfkuc9
transaction
21f63929102db148c9432c879f8d1421e50cc4a1ade4e94a65276da69c46ac62
spent
true